Most every employer comprises various teams. The large versions are often called business units or departments. Of course, they can also be smaller assemblages of employees—committees, workgroups or ...
This is the sixth in a series of newsletters that have been discussing a seldom-mentioned IT discipline – Application Performance Engineering (APE). In this newsletter we will discuss how establishing ...
Whether a device is a Mac, iPhone, or iPad, every piece of hardware Apple makes needs to go through several prototype and development stages. Here's what that looks like, and what Apple calls each ...
At its core, DevOps is a philosophy that emphasizes communication and collaboration between development and operations teams and continuous testing and release of new features on a regular basis. And ...
Thirty years ago, Java 1.0 revolutionized software development. Every Java demo featured a simple "Hello World" dialog window with the only available option: Java's Abstract Window Toolkit, the first ...
When I was managing software development, one of the messiest and least efficient areas was the system test region that was set up so programmers could unit test their applications. In the fray of ...